在一些laravel示例中,我看到资产被调用如下:
@H_404_1@<link rel="icon" type="image/png" href="{{ asset('icons/favicon-32x32.png') }}" sizes="32x32">
使用该方法的优势是什么,而不是这样做?
@H_404_1@<link rel="icon" type="image/png" href="icons/favicon-32x32.png" sizes="32x32">
如果您执行后者,当您使用包含正斜杠的任何URL时,URL将不起作用.例如.如果你在主页上,不使用资产似乎工作正常,但如果你在/搜索/结果或其他什么,URL将是不正确的(因为它将寻找/ search / icons / favicon- 32×32.png).